T’aet’an-ŭp has a population of 64,258, making it the 46th largest place we list in North Korea. It is in South Hwanghae.
T’aet’an-ŭp holds 0.24% of North Korea's 26,633,691 people. Pyongyang, the largest place we list there, is 50 times its size.
